With 39,097 people, ZIP 37604 is a ZIP code in Washington County. 50% of homes are owner-occupied. The poverty rate is 21.9%, above the 12.5% national rate. This skews young, with a median age of 35.4. The foreign-born share is 5%. Getting to work takes 18 minutes on average. Among the 7 ZIP codes in Washington County, 37604 ranks 6th by median household income.

Frequently asked

How many people live in ZIP code 37604?

ZIP code 37604 has about 39,097 residents according to the 2024 American Community Survey.

What is the median household income in ZIP code 37604?

The typical household in ZIP code 37604 earns about $52,345 a year. Half of households make more than that, and half make less.

Is ZIP code 37604 expensive?

In ZIP code 37604, the median home is worth about $259,600, and the typical rent is about $1,055 a month.

How educated are people in ZIP code 37604?

About 40.8% of adults age 25 and over in ZIP code 37604 hold a bachelor's degree or higher.

What is the poverty rate in ZIP code 37604?

About 21.9% of people in ZIP code 37604 live below the federal poverty line.
